2008-09-17 8 views
2

私はABAPプログラムを使用して、お客様に電子メールの請求書を送信します。 請求書は、機能SX_OBJECT_CONVERT_OTF_PDFで作成されたPDF添付です。 問題は、言語がPL(ポーランド語)の場合、EN言語に比べて10倍大きいことです。どうして?SAPからの電子メールの大きなpdac attachemts

答えて

1

これは、OSにデフォルトでインストールされていない特定のフォント(特殊文字)を使用することがあります。したがって、pdfコンバータは、ドキュメントを宛先に正しくレンダリングするために、完全なフォントをドキュメントに含めます。

これはちょっとした思考です。

3

おそらく、ガンスティックの回答が正しいでしょう。 Sap note:843480でこの問題について説明します。

リリース620以降では、pdf要素(フォントなど)を圧縮するためのサポートパッチがあります。結果として得られるpdfは唯一の英語のものよりも大きくなりますが、おそらく10倍より小さくなります。

0

あなたはこれを試してみてください可能性がありますhttp://lucattelli.com/blog/?page_id=478

このFMはバイナリPDFを取り、64をベースとメールの添付ファイルとして送信するためにそれを変換することができます。

役立つかどうかを確認

関連する問題